Weather Conditions
The weather significantly impacts driving conditions. Rain, snow, or fog can drastically reduce visibility, making it more difficult for drivers to react to unexpected situations. Extreme temperatures can also affect road surfaces and driver alertness. For example, black ice, a thin layer of ice on a road that is hard to see, can lead to dangerous skidding incidents, especially in the winter months.
Sudden downpours can cause hydroplaning, where vehicles lose traction on the road surface, increasing the risk of accidents.

Traffic Volume and Congestion, Car accident fort worth texas today
Heavy traffic volume and congestion increase the risk of rear-end collisions and other types of accidents. Slow speeds and close proximity between vehicles create less time for drivers to react to unexpected situations, especially if sudden braking or lane changes are required. In congested areas, visibility can also be limited, making it difficult to see what is happening in front of the vehicle.
Congestion often results in a domino effect, with one accident leading to a cascade of additional incidents.
Driver Behaviors
Driver behaviors are another significant factor. Speeding, distracted driving, and aggressive driving are all common causes of accidents. Drivers who fail to follow traffic laws and safety procedures increase the likelihood of an accident. For instance, a driver exceeding the speed limit reduces their reaction time, increasing the risk of a collision in a sudden situation. Likewise, drivers who are distracted by their phones or other devices are more prone to accidents.

Safe Driving Tips
Understanding the nuances of safe driving is paramount to reducing accidents. Consistent adherence to these guidelines can drastically improve safety outcomes. These aren’t just suggestions; they’re essential practices.
- Prioritize defensive driving techniques. Anticipate potential hazards and maintain a safe following distance. For example, if a vehicle ahead suddenly brakes, adequate distance allows for reaction time and avoids a rear-end collision.
- Adhere to posted speed limits. Excessive speed significantly reduces reaction time and increases the severity of collisions. Speeding is a leading cause of accidents, and maintaining the speed limit is a cornerstone of accident prevention.
- Maintain vehicle upkeep. Regular inspections and necessary repairs are crucial. Tires, brakes, and lights should be checked regularly to ensure safe operation.
- Avoid distractions. Cell phones, eating, and other activities divert attention from the road. Drivers should minimize distractions to avoid accidents.
